Abstract

In Product design process, aspects related to the manufacturing process and supply chain should be considered. The design is produced not only satisfy for consumers needs but it fulfilled the constraints related to manufacturingand supply chain aspects. This research aims to make a model to determine the cheapest product design from both of manufacturing process and supply chain. This research uses binary programming as an approach. The cost aspects used in this research are component’s manufacturing cost, supplier fixed contact cost, assembly operation cost and quality improvement cost. The result of research, a physical product design with the lowest total cost by combining components from several designs and adding the value constraint on the quality specification.
